According to the research of well-known genealogist, Donald Jacobus, Ebenezer Booth married two wives. First, Hannah________; and second, Elizabeth Jones b. 1665, d. June 1709. Elizabeth was daughter of Richard and Elizabeth (Carpenter) Jones. New England Marriages Prior to 1700 also shows both marriages. Unfortunately, several charts have combined the two women into one, but this appear to be incorrect.
Hannah's maiden name is unknown but she was the mother of two children, as recorded in Stratford, CT records. 1. Abiah, b. 19 Oct 1674; d. before 13 March 1740/41; m. Lt. Joseph Beach 2. Richard, b. 9 May 1679 d. young.
No marriage record was found but based on 1674 birthdate of eldest child, Ebenezer and Hannah were probably md around 1673 in Stratford, CT.
Based on 1686 birth date of eldest child born to 2nd wife Elizabeth, their marriage was probably around 1685, thus Hannah was dead by this time.
